slide1. Fundamentals of Language Teaching through Technology<br>
slide2. The "Fundamentals of Language Teaching through Technology" refers to the core principles and approaches used to integrate technology into language learning.<br>
slide3. Key Elements Blended Learning: Combining traditional classroom teaching with digital resources and online platforms. This includes tools like Learning Management Systems (LMS), virtual classrooms, and multimedia resources.<br>
slide4. Computer-Assisted Language Learning (CALL): Using software, apps, or online platforms specifically designed to help learners develop language skills. CALL programs may include grammar exercises, vocabulary builders, and pronunciation tools.<br>
slide5. Mobile-Assisted Language Learning (MALL): Learning a language through mobile devices (phones, tablets), often involving apps or mobile-friendly websites that facilitate anytime, anywhere learning.<br>
slide6. Interactive Multimedia: Using videos, audio recordings, games, and simulations to create a rich language-learning experience. Tools like language learning apps (e.g., Duolingo, Memrise) use multimedia to make learning more engaging.<br>
slide7. Online Communication Tools: Utilizing communication platforms like Zoom, Skype, or even chatbots to foster interaction in the target language. These tools can simulate real-life conversations and offer instant feedback.<br>
slide8. Gamification: Integrating elements of game design (points, levels, challenges) into learning platforms to make language acquisition more engaging and motivating.<br>
slide9. Artificial Intelligence (AI): AI-driven tools can personalize language learning by adapting to the learner's proficiency level and providing tailored feedback. Examples include chatbots and intelligent tutoring systems.<br>
slide10. Automated Assessment Tools: These tools provide instant feedback on language tasks, such as pronunciation, grammar, or writing, often powered by AI. They help learners track their progress without needing constant teacher input.<br>
slide11. Virtual Reality (VR) & Augmented Reality (AR): These emerging technologies allow for immersive language experiences. Learners can engage in virtual environments where they interact in the target language.<br>
slide12. Data Analytics: Tracking learner performance through digital tools and analytics to personalize the learning experience, identifying strengths and weaknesses.<br>
slide13. These fundamentals or key elements focus on enhancing language learning through the effective use of digital tools, making it more interactive, accessible, and adaptable to individual needs.<br>
slide14. Core principles Integration of Digital Tools
Learning Management Systems (LMS): Platforms like Moodle or Blackboard allow teachers to organize materials, communicate with students, and track progress.
Language Learning Apps: Apps like Duolingo, Memrise, or Babbel provide structured, interactive lessons with real-time feedback.
Multimedia Resources: Videos, podcasts, interactive games, and digital flashcards make learning more dynamic.<br>
slide15. 2. Personalization
Adaptive Learning Systems: AI-powered tools can adjust content and difficulty based on the learner’s pace and performance. This ensures that students get targeted practice in areas where they need the most help.
Customization of Content: Teachers can tailor lessons to specific learners' needs, interests, and proficiency levels using digital platforms.<br>
slide16. 3. Interactive and Immersive Learning
Gamification: Introducing game elements like rewards, points, and challenges into learning apps can motivate students and make practice enjoyable.
Augmented Reality (AR) & Virtual Reality (VR): These technologies create immersive environments where learners can practice language in real-life scenarios or cultural contexts.
Simulations: Virtual classrooms or real-world simulations provide opportunities to practice conversations, vocabulary, and situational language use.<br>
slide17. 4. Collaboration and Communication
Online Collaboration Tools: Platforms like Google Meet, Zoom, and Microsoft Teams facilitate live interactions, group work, and discussions in the target language.
Discussion Forums and Social Media: These platforms enable students to engage in conversations with native speakers or peers, providing real-world language practice.<br>
slide18. 5. Access to Authentic Language Materials
Content from Native Speakers: Podcasts, YouTube videos, blogs, and online newspapers expose learners to authentic, everyday language usage.
Real-Time Translation Tools: Applications like Google Translate or DeepL allow learners to understand and practice translations instantly, although careful guidance is needed to prevent over-reliance.<br>
slide19. 6. Automated Feedback and Assessment
AI-Driven Feedback: Tools like Grammarly or speech recognition software provide instant feedback on pronunciation, grammar, and writing.
Automated Assessments: Online quizzes, writing assessments, and language proficiency tests can be administered automatically, allowing learners to gauge their progress without waiting for instructor feedback.<br>
slide20. 7. Flexibility and Accessibility
Asynchronous Learning: Students can learn at their own pace through pre-recorded videos, downloadable materials, or apps, making it easier to fit language learning into their schedule.
Mobile-Assisted Language Learning (MALL): Learning on mobile devices allows students to study on-the-go, access lessons anywhere, and make learning more convenient.<br>
slide21. 8. Data-Driven Teaching
Learner Analytics: Teachers can analyze data on student performance, such as quiz scores or activity logs, to identify strengths, weaknesses, and trends. This helps in personalizing learning and improving outcomes.
Adaptive Testing: Tools that adjust the difficulty of tests based on the learner’s answers to accurately gauge their level of proficiency.<br>
slide22. 9. Engagement through Multimodal Learning
Visual, Auditory, and Kinesthetic: Integrating different media (videos, audio, interactive tasks) ensures learners with different styles can benefit, making language teaching more inclusive.<br>
slide23. 10. Collaboration between Educators and Technology Providers
Teacher Training: Teachers need training to effectively use technology in the classroom, such as learning how to operate new platforms, designing tech-based lessons, and troubleshooting common issues.
Continuous Development: Teachers and language technology providers should collaborate to keep content up-to-date and aligned with language learning best practices and curricula.<br>
